s390/test_unwind: use raw opcode instead of invalid instruction
[ Upstream commit 53ae723091
]
Building with clang & LLVM_IAS=1 leads to an error:
arch/s390/lib/test_unwind.c:179:4: error: invalid register pair
" mvcl %%r1,%%r1\n"
^
The test creates an invalid instruction that would trap at runtime, but the
LLVM inline assembler tries to validate it at compile time too.
Use the raw instruction opcode instead.
